Overview

M0G3507QPTRQ1 from Texas Instruments is an automotive-grade 32-bit Arm® Cortex®-M0+ microcontroller with CAN-FD interface, 128KB flash (ECC), 32KB SRAM (parity), and operation up to 80MHz. It integrates dual 12-bit 4Msps ADCs, 12-bit DAC, two zero-drift OPAs, three comparators, and supports ASIL B functional safety for body electronics and gateway applications.

Technical Context

The M0G3507QPTRQ1 implements a memory protection unit (MPU) and 7-channel DMA to support deterministic real-time execution in automotive control loops. Its dual ADCs enable simultaneous sampling across up to 16 external channels with hardware averaging for 14-bit effective resolution at 250ksps - critical for torque estimation and position sensing.

Integrated analog resources include programmable gain stages (up to 32×) on OPAs, 8-bit reference DACs per comparator, and configurable shared VREF (1.4V/2.5V), enabling direct sensor-to-digital signal chains without external components. The CAN-FD peripheral supports data rates up to 5Mbps and payloads up to 64 bytes for high-bandwidth vehicle network communication.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
CoreArm Cortex-M0+, 80MHz max - enables real-time motor control loop execution within 12.5ns instruction cycle time
Flash / SRAM128KB flash with ECC + 32KB SRAM with parity - ensures code/data integrity in harsh automotive environments
Operating Temp–40°C to +125°C - qualified for under-hood and cabin-mounted automotive modules
Supply Voltage1.62V to 3.6V - compatible with 3.3V and 2.5V system rails; supports battery brownout resilience
ADC PerformanceDual 12-bit, 4Msps with 17-channel mux - allows synchronized current/voltage sampling for 3-phase inverter monitoring
CAN InterfaceCAN 2.0B + CAN-FD (5Mbps) - enables legacy CAN node compatibility and high-throughput firmware updates over vehicle networks
Low-Power ModesSTANDBY: 1.5µA (RTC + SRAM + CPU state retained); SHUTDOWN: 80nA with IO wake capability - extends battery life in always-on modules

Pinout & Package

Package: 48-pin LQFP (PT), 9mm × 9mm, 0.5mm pitch, RoHS-compliant, AEC-Q100 Grade 1 qualified.

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
PA19 / PA20SWDIO / SWCLK2-pin serial wire debug interface - enables non-intrusive firmware debugging and flash programming in production test
PA12 / PA13CAN_TX / CAN_RXDedicated CAN-FD physical layer interface - requires external CAN transceiver (e.g., TCAN1042-Q1) for bus connection
PA14 / PA15 / PA16A0_12 / DAC_OUT / A1_1Analog input channel 12, DAC output, and OPA1 output - supports closed-loop analog output control with programmable gain
PA21 / PA23VREF− / VREF+Configurable internal voltage reference inputs - sets precision ADC/DAC/COMP reference without external components
PA25 / PA24 / PA22A0_2 / A0_3 / A0_7ADC0 input channels - routed to high-precision analog front-end with dedicated OPA/GPAMP signal paths
NRSTActive-low resetAsynchronous reset input with internal pull-up - ensures deterministic startup after power-on or brownout recovery

Key Features

Feature Design Value
ASIL B CertificationTÜV-certified per ISO 26262 - reduces functional safety validation effort for automotive body control modules
Zero-Drift OPAs0.5µV/°C drift with chopping - enables stable DC-coupled sensor amplification over full temperature range
Math AcceleratorHardware DIV/SQRT/MAC/TRIG - offloads motor control algorithms (FOC, PID) from CPU, freeing 15–20% core bandwidth
Programmable Analog RoutingDirect interconnect between ADC, OPAs, COMP, DAC, GPAMP - eliminates external op-amp routing and reduces PCB area
Wettable Flank OptionAvailable on 48-pin LQFP - enables automated optical inspection (AOI) of solder joints in automotive manufacturing
High-Speed TimersTwo 16-bit advanced timers with deadband and complementary outputs - supports 6-channel 3-phase inverter gate drive with <100ns timing precision

Applications

Automotive Body Control Module Steering Wheel Control Unit

Use Scenario: Centralized control of door locks, window lifts, mirror adjustment, and interior lighting via LIN/CAN networks.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Main MCU executing real-time PWM for motor drivers, ADC sampling for position sensors, and CAN-FD communication with gateway.

Use Value: Integrated 128KB flash stores multi-variant firmware; STANDBY mode (1.5µA) maintains RTC and wake-on-LIN while minimizing parasitic drain.

Use Scenario: Real-time processing of multifunction switch inputs, haptic feedback, and capacitive touch detection on steering wheel.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Sensor hub aggregating analog (potentiometer), digital (switch), and capacitive inputs; drives haptic actuator via DAC/PWM.

Use Value: Dual ADCs sample 16+ analog channels simultaneously; zero-drift OPAs condition low-level potentiometer signals with <1mV offset error over temperature.

Vehicle Occupancy Detection Kick-to-Open Rear Gate Module

Use Scenario: Processing ultrasonic or capacitive seat sensors to detect occupant presence/position for airbag deployment logic.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Signal conditioner and classifier MCU - digitizes analog sensor outputs, runs lightweight ML inference on SRAM-resident model.

Use Value: Hardware CRC-32 and AES-128 ensure secure sensor data integrity; 32KB SRAM holds neural network weights and feature buffers.

Use Scenario: Detecting foot motion beneath rear bumper using PIR or ultrasonic sensors, then triggering liftgate actuation.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Low-power event processor - wakes from SHUTDOWN (80nA) on sensor interrupt, samples ADC, validates gesture, asserts relay control.

Use Value: 80nA shutdown current extends 12V battery life >5 years; integrated comparators with 8-bit DAC references enable adaptive thresholding for varying ambient conditions.

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ar automotive microcontroller applications.

Alternative Part Technical Difference Application Difference Selection Advice
M0G3506QPTRQ164KB flash, 32KB SRAM - 64KB less program memory, same peripherals and packageSuitable for cost-sensitive modules with smaller firmware footprint (e.g., simple lighting controllers)Select when application firmware fits in 64KB and no future feature expansion is planned
SPC560B50L3Power Architecture e200z0, 64MHz, 512KB flash, 48KB RAM, no integrated DAC/OPARequires external analog signal chain; targets higher ASIL levels (ASIL D capable) in powertrainChoose for legacy Power Architecture ecosystems or where larger memory and higher ASIL compliance outweigh analog integration needs

Compared with M0G3506QPTRQ1, the M0G3507QPTRQ1 provides 64KB additional flash for OTA update staging and enhanced diagnostics; versus SPC560B50L3, it delivers superior analog integration and lower system BOM cost but targets ASIL B rather than ASIL D.

FAQ

What automotive qualification does the M0G3507QPTRQ1 meet?

The M0G3507QPTRQ1 is AEC-Q100 Grade 1 qualified (–40°C to +125°C) and ISO 26262 certified up to ASIL B by TÜV. This certification covers systematic capability and hardware integrity for use in automotive body electronics, gateways, and comfort systems where failure could impact safety but not directly cause injury.

Does the M0G3507QPTRQ1 support CAN-FD, and what are its data rate capabilities?

Yes, the M0G3507QPTRQ1 includes a native CAN-FD controller supporting both CAN 2.0A/B and CAN-FD protocols. It achieves data rates up to 5Mbps in FD mode with payloads up to 64 bytes, enabling faster firmware updates and richer diagnostic messaging compared to classical CAN.

How many analog-to-digital converter channels does the M0G3507QPTRQ1 support in its 48-pin LQFP package?

In the 48-pin LQFP (PT) package, the M0G3507QPTRQ1 supports up to 16 external ADC input channels across its dual 12-bit 4Msps ADCs. Pin assignments include PA14 (A0_12), PA15–PA25 (A1_0 through A0_7), and PB17–PB24 (A1_4 through A0_5), with full routing flexibility via the IOMUX.

What low-power modes are available on the M0G3507QPTRQ1, and what is the lowest current consumption?

The M0G3507QPTRQ1 offers RUN, SLEEP, STOP, STANDBY, and SHUTDOWN modes. The lowest active-retention mode is STANDBY at 1.5µA (RTC + SRAM + CPU state retained); the absolute minimum is SHUTDOWN at 80nA with IO wake capability - ideal for battery-powered always-on modules.

Is the M0G3507QPTRQ1 pin-compatible with other members of the MSPM0G350x family in the same package?

Yes, all MSPM0G350x-Q1 devices in the 48-pin LQFP (PT) package - including M0G3505QPTRQ1, M0G3506QPTRQ1, and M0G3507QPTRQ1 - share identical pinouts and electrical characteristics. Firmware and hardware designs are interchangeable at the board level; only flash/RAM capacity differs.
